macOS Installation

Install Breeze on macOS using the signed tarball and installer script.

Before You Begin

Confirm that the target hosts meet the Requirements and can reach the Breeze service over TCP 443.

Download the Installer

  1. In Cloudaware, go to Admin.
  2. Find Breeze in DevOps Integrations. Click CONFIGURED.
  3. Download the macOS agent archive (breeze-agent*.tgz) for your platform.

Install Breeze

Run the installer as root (or with sudo):

tar xf breeze-agent*.tgz
cd breeze-agent
./install.sh

The installer configures a cron job to run every ~15 minutes and installs the agent under /opt/breeze-agent.

Verify the Installation

  • Cron entry: cat /etc/cron.d/breeze-agent
  • Manual run: cd /opt/breeze-agent && ./app.sh
  • Logs (default): /opt/breeze-agent/var/log/breeze-agent.log for scheduled runs. Manual runs print to STDOUT.

After the first run completes successfully, the agent starts streaming OS-level facts into the Cloudaware CMDB and receives self-updates from Breeze Server when new versions are available.

Upgrade/Uninstall

To upgrade Breeze, install a newer package over the existing installation. The configuration under /opt/breeze-agent is preserved.

To uninstall, run the uninstall script:

sudo /opt/cloudaware/breeze/uninstall.sh
